Roboget is a portable tool designed to automate the process of getting downloads and apps directly.

Roboget's focus is on providing safe and direct download links as well as acting as a GUI for Wget and cURL. Wget supports HTTP, HTTPS, and FTP protocols, as well as retrieval through HTTP proxies. cURL is shipped on Windows 10 1706 and up. Besides this also the external download manager JDownloader can be integrated to intercept download links from Roboget.
